General Information

  • Manufacturer: Hewlett Packard Enterprise (HPE)
  • Part Number: 649871-001
  • Product Type: Ethernet Network Adapter
  • Device Category: Multi-Port Server NIC

Technical Specifications

  • Bus Type: PCI Express 2.0 x4
  • PCIe Revision: 2.0 compliant
  • Slot Requirement: 1 x PCIe x4 slot
  • Card Type: Plug-in expansion network adapter

HPE 331T 4-Port Ethernet Adapter

  • 4 x RJ-45 Ethernet ports for flexible connectivity
  • Supports traffic segmentation and load balancing
  • Improves network redundancy and uptime

Low Profile PCIe Design

  • Space-saving form factor
  • Ideal for rack-mounted servers
  • Easy installation in PCIe slots

Network Controller & Processor

  • Chipset: Broadcom BCM5719
  • Architecture: Enterprise-class Ethernet controller
  • Processing Capability: Efficient packet handling and routing

Data Transfer Performance

  • Speed Per Port: Up to 1 Gbps
  • Total Ports: 4 independent Ethernet channels
  • Performance Mode: Full-duplex Gigabit support

Supported Ethernet Standards

  • 10BASE-T (10 Mbps)
  • 100BASE-TX (Fast Ethernet)
  • 1000BASE-T (Gigabit Ethernet)

NIC Teaming and Load Balancing Capabilities

The adapter supports NIC teaming configurations that allow multiple ports to function together as a unified logical interface. This enables load balancing across network paths while also providing redundancy in case of link failure. In enterprise environments, this ensures continuous availability of critical applications and services even during hardware or network disruptions.
